Kindle for Mac on the Wheels, Hop On

The Kindle for Mac has finally arrived after much anticipation giving Mac computer owners across 100 countries round  the globe, a free access to the 450,000 Kindle books. The announcement that came shortly after the application was launched on its website, will work on Intel Macs running Mac OS X 10.5 or later. Tommy Hilfiger gets a new owner- Calvin Klein

The American fashion label Tommy Hilfiger will now be a part of the New York based fashion brand Calvin Klein as a 2.2 billion euros (£2 billion)  deal strikes between the owners of the brands. Phillips-Van Heusen, which bought Calvin Klein in 2003 agreed upon taking over the clothing company Tommy Hilfiger that was currently under the ownership of British buyout group Apax Partners. Twitter announces @Anywhere platform

Twitter CEO Evan Williams announced a new platform @Anywhere at the SXSW Interactive conference in Austin, Texas. The new service will allow the users to integrate the Twitter experience on their websites boosting further Twitter’s reach across the web.
